Considering that stress and anxiety disorders are a team of associated conditions instead of a solitary disorder, signs and symptoms might vary from individual to individual. One individual might experience from extreme stress and anxiety attacks that strike without caution, while one more gets panicky at the idea of mingling at an event. Somebody else may have problem with a disabling worry of driving, or uncontrollable, invasive thoughts.


Regardless of their different forms, all anxiety conditions illegal an extreme worry or worry out of proportion to the circumstance at hand. While having an anxiousness problem can be disabling, preventing you from living the life you want, it's vital to know that you're not the only one. Anxiousness problems are amongst one of the most usual mental wellness issuesand are highly treatable.


Nonetheless, typically when individuals talk regarding anxiousness attacks, they're truly describing anxiety attack. These are episodes of extreme panic or fear. They typically happen suddenly and without warning. In some cases there's an evident triggergetting embeded a lift, for instance, or thinking about the huge speech you need to givebut in various other instances, the strikes appear of heaven.

Throughout that brief time, you may experience fear so serious that you really feel as if you're about to die or absolutely shed control. The physical symptoms are themselves so frightening that several people believe they're having a cardiac arrest. Natural remedies for anxiety. After an anxiety attack mores than, you might fret regarding having an additional one, specifically in a public area where aid isn't readily available or you can not quickly get away


Really feeling of shedding control or freaking out. Heart palpitations or breast pain. Seeming like you're going to lose consciousness. Problem breathing or choking experience. Hyperventilation. Warm flashes or cools. Trembling or shaking. Nausea or stomach pains. Really feeling removed or unreal. It's essential to seek aid if you're beginning to prevent certain situations because you're worried of having a panic strike.

However, anxiety may commonly be the result of several aspects, consisting of genes and life experiences. Research studies of doubles and households suggest that, to some extent, stress and anxiety might be genetic. In various other words, some individuals might just be a lot more genetically susceptible to being nervous. Experiencing physical or psychological abuse and disregard can activate an anxiousness condition.
